Contemplative Activism
Nonviolence as Biblical Response to Injustice
Explores nonviolence as a biblical response to injustice through scripture, reflection, and creative expression.

Taught by writer Dorcas Cheng-Tozun, the course examines how Jesus modeled nonviolent resistance and challenges the myth of redemptive violence.

What you’ll learn and practice
- Gain a biblical perspective of nonviolence as an essential component of following Jesus
- Understand the myth of redemptive violence and the harm it causes
- Learn how to practice nonviolence in your own life
